Почему WP частично цепляет файл перевода

djdiplomat
На сайте с 05.08.2009
Offline
136
462

Не пашет конструкция __() ....

Не могу понять почему не переводит. Что в __(). во втором файле wp-crm-system-vars.php.

Хотя в файле перевода прописаны переводы для всех слов...

/* Load Text Domain */

add_action('plugins_loaded', 'wp_crm_plugin_init');

function wp_crm_plugin_init() {

load_plugin_textdomain( 'wp-crm-system', false, dirname( plugin_basename( __FILE__ ) ) . '/lang' );

}

include(plugin_dir_path( __FILE__ ) . 'includes/wp-crm-system-vars.php');

_e('Please create a contact first.','wp-crm-system');

...

if ( $customField[ 'type' ] == "selectpriority" ) {

$args = array(''=>__('Select an option', 'wp-crm-system'),'low'=>_x('Low','Not of great importance','wp-crm-system'),'medium'=>_x('Medium','Average priority','wp-crm-system'),'high'=>_x('High','Greatest importance','wp-crm-system'));

}

...

wp-crm-system-vars.php

if ( ! defined( 'ABSPATH' ) ) {

exit; // Exit if accessed directly

}

$prefix = '_wpcrm_';

$postTypes = array( 'wpcrm-contact', 'wpcrm-task', 'wpcrm-organization', 'wpcrm-opportunity', 'wpcrm-project' );

if (!defined('WPCRM_USER_ACCESS')){

define( 'WPCRM_USER_ACCESS', get_option('wpcrm_system_select_user_role') );

}

if (!defined('WPCRM_BASE_STORE_URL')){

define( 'WPCRM_BASE_STORE_URL', 'http://wp-crm.com' );

}

if (!defined('WPCRM_BASE_PLUGIN_PATH')){

define( 'WPCRM_BASE_PLUGIN_PATH', dirname(dirname( __FILE__ )) );

}

/**

* Set titles for fields in wpCRMSystemCustomFields

*/

if (!defined('WPCRM_ACTIVE')){

define( 'WPCRM_ACTIVE', __('Active', 'wp-crm-system') ); - вот это не переводит.. и далее куча таких похожих строк

}

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ий